Panama To Issue $1.4 Billion Of New Global Bond
Following its recent swap offer, which saw the sovereign accept $1.062 billion of shorter-dated paper, Panama will issue $1.363 billion 30-year bonds. The bonds, which mature in 2036, will be issued with a coupon of 6.7%. The government had been hoping to swap up to $2.8 billion of its shorter-dated bonds and published the initial swap terms earlier this week. The bonds being exchanged were the 2020, 2023, 2027, 2029 and 2034. The deal was jointly managed by HSBC and JP Morgan.
